EU Commission Prez posts video attending R-Day celebrations, says ‘It’s honour of a lifetime’
In a historic moment, European Union Commission President Ursula von der Leyen shared a heartfelt video on social media, showcasing her attendance at the Republic Day celebrations in India, where she was the chief guest. The video, which has gone viral, captures the essence of the grand event and highlights the strong bond between India and the European Union. Alongside European Council President Antonio Costa, Ursula von der Leyen can be seen enjoying the festivities, beaming with pride and enthusiasm.
As she posted the video, Ursula expressed her gratitude and admiration for the invitation, stating that attending the Republic Day celebrations was “the honour of a lifetime.” Her words reflect the significance of the occasion and the importance of the relationship between India and the EU. The European Union Commission President’s presence at the event underscores the growing collaboration and cooperation between the two entities, which is expected to have far-reaching benefits for both parties.
In her post, Ursula von der Leyen emphasized the importance of a strong and prosperous India, stating that “a successful India makes the world more stable, prosperous and secure.” Her statement highlights the global implications of India’s growth and development, which extends beyond its borders to have a positive impact on the world at large. By acknowledging the significance of India’s success, Ursula von der Leyen is acknowledging the country’s emergence as a major player on the global stage.
The EU Commission President’s words are a testament to the mutual benefits of the India-EU partnership. As she noted, “it benefits everyone” when India experiences success and growth. One of the highlights of the Republic Day celebrations was the participation of an EU contingent in the marching parade. The contingent’s presence was a symbol of the strong bond between India and the EU, and it marked a historic moment in the relationship between the two entities. The marching parade is an integral part of the Republic Day celebrations, and the inclusion of the EU contingent added a new dimension to the event.
The video shared by Ursula von der Leyen offers a glimpse into the grandeur and spectacle of the Republic Day celebrations. The footage shows the EU Commission President and European Council President Antonio Costa watching the parade, which featured a diverse range of performances and displays.
